The period of a journey by air between Boston, Massachusetts, and Los Angeles, California, is influenced by a large number of things. These components embrace the particular route taken, prevailing wind situations, and air site visitors management directives. Direct itineraries typically take between 5 and a half and 6 and a half hours. Connecting flights, whereas probably inexpensive, can considerably prolong the general journey period, typically by a number of hours.

1. Distance

Distance performs a foundational position in figuring out the period of a flight between Boston and Los Angeles. Whereas not the only real determinant, the sheer bodily separation between these two cities establishes a baseline minimal journey time. Understanding how this distance interacts with different components gives useful perception into potential variations in total journey size.

  • Nice Circle Distance

    Essentially the most related distance metric for air journey is the great-circle distance, representing the shortest path between two factors on a sphere. For Boston and Los Angeles, this distance is roughly 2,600 miles. This determine serves as a core ingredient in calculating estimated flight instances, as plane should traverse no less than this distance, no matter different components.

3. Winds

Wind situations play a major position in figuring out the precise flight time between Boston and Los Angeles. The impression of wind, significantly at excessive altitudes the place jetliners function, can add or subtract substantial time from the anticipated period primarily based solely on distance and plane velocity. Understanding the affect of wind patterns is essential for correct flight planning and managing traveler expectations.

  • Jet Stream Affect

    The jet stream, a band of sturdy winds excessive within the environment, exerts a significant affect on transcontinental flight instances. Westbound flights from Boston to Los Angeles sometimes encounter headwinds from the jet stream, growing journey time. Conversely, eastbound flights typically profit from tailwinds, decreasing journey time. The energy and place of the jet stream differ seasonally and even every day, making its impression a dynamic consider flight planning.

  • Headwinds and Tailwinds

    Headwinds, blowing straight in opposition to the plane’s path of journey, enhance air resistance and successfully cut back the plane’s floor velocity, resulting in longer flight instances. Tailwinds, pushing the plane from behind, have the other impact, growing floor velocity and shortening flight instances. Even seemingly average wind speeds can have a cumulative impact over the lengthy distance between Boston and Los Angeles.

8. Connecting Flights

Connecting flights symbolize a major issue influencing total journey time between Boston and Los Angeles. Whereas direct flights provide the shortest journey period, connecting itineraries regularly current a trade-off between price and time. Understanding the implications of connecting flights is essential for vacationers looking for to steadiness price range issues with environment friendly journey planning.

The first impression of connecting flights on total journey period stems from layover instances. A layover introduces a ready interval between flights, starting from as little as one hour to probably a number of hours, relying on the particular itinerary. This ready interval provides on to the full journey time. For instance, a connecting flight with a two-hour layover in Chicago would add two hours to the general period in comparison with a direct flight. Moreover, connecting flights typically contain much less direct routing. As a substitute of following a comparatively straight path, the plane may journey by way of a number of airports, including distance and consequently growing flight time. As an illustration, a connecting flight routing by way of Denver may cowl a larger total distance than a direct flight, contributing to an extended journey.
